Sonakshi Sinha wiki and pics


Sonakshi Sinha is an Indian Bollywood actress and voice actress born 2 June 1987. She marked her debut in the Hindi film industry with 2010's Dabangg opposite Salman Khan, which went onto become the highest grossing Bollywood film of the year. Sinha received positive reviews for her performance, as well as the Filmfare Award for Best Female Debut. Post her debut, she went on to star in some of Bollywood's biggest hits, including Rowdy Rathore, Son of Sardar and Dabangg 2.


Early life  

She is the daughter of an actor and a politician Shatrughan Sinha and Poonam Sinha. She is the youngest of three children with two twin brothers, Luv Sinha and Kussh Sinha. She studied Fashion Designing at Shreemati Nathibai Damodar Thackersey Women's University[3] in Mumbai.

Career  

Early career & film debut (2010) 

Sinha started her career as a costume designer. She designed costumes for movie Mera Dil Leke Deko in 2005. and walked the ramp at the Lakme Fashion Week 2008[4] and then again in Lakme Fashion Week 2009.[4]
She made her acting debut in the 2010 film Dabangg co-starring Salman Khan. It went on to become one of the highest grossing Bollywood films.[5] Speaking of her role, she said that she had to lost 30 kg over two years to prepare for her character of a village girl by a combination of proper diet and vigorous exercise. She added that she had been observing people and trying to pick up nuances as a step of further preparation.[6]
She featured as the cover girl of Indian edition of Maxim magazine for the month December 2010.[7] Although Sinha had no film release in 2011, she won quite a few awards for her debut. This included the Filmfare Award as well as the IIFA Awards among many others.
Breakthrough & initial success (2012–present)  
Sinha had four releases in 2012, her first being Prabhu Deva's Rowdy Rathore, opposite Akshay Kumar. The film opened to mixed reviews from critics,[8] although had a strong opening at the box office,[9] collecting approx. 15.06 crore (US$2.8 million) on the first day and eventually becoming a "Blockbuster".[10] Her next film, Shirish Kunder's Joker, also opposite Akshay Kumar proved to be unsuccessful at the box office, and received overwhelmingly negative reviews.[11][12] Her last two films, Ashwni Dhir's Son Of Sardar alongside Ajay Devgan, and Arbaaz Khan's Dabangg 2, the sequel to her immensely successful debut, were both successful at the box office, despite receiving mixed reviews.[13][14][15][16] As a result of the strong collections her films were gathering at the box office, she was recognised by ETC Business Awards, as the Highest Grossing actress of 2012.[17]
Sinha will be next seen in Vikramaditya Motwane's period romance-drama Lootera opposite Ranveer Singh. She is currently filming for Once Upon a Time Again, the sequel to Once Upon A Time In Mumbaai, once again alongside Akshay Kumar, as well as Imran Khan; Prabhu Deva's Rambo Rajkumar opposite Shahid Kapoor; and the remake of Thuppakki also opposite Akshay Kumar.

In the media  

Sinha's weight has always been a frequent discussion in the media. She's one of the few actresses however not afraid to talk about such issue even slamming the media for their focus on weight, criticism of actresses like herself and pressures they put on women to be movie star fit.[18] She's considered a role model to many young woman fighting to break the size zero mold.
